Public vigilance due to increase in child care cases claim experts

A huge increase in awareness of child abuse is behind statistics showing a massive increase in local authority involvement

QualitySolicitors Mander Cruickshank say increased vigilance by the public is primarily the reason that there has been a 62 per cent increase in local authority care cases since 2007.

Senior partner at the firm Jim Abbott said the figures should be taken into context, rather than the public believing there is an increase in child cruelty.

“The Baby P case in London, which came to the public’s attention in the summer of 2007 has certainly changed the attitude to child cruelty, with people much more willing to report if they have concerns than they did before,” said Mr Abbott, who has been a recognised legal expert on the Law Society’s Children’s Panel for more than 20 years.

“The shifting in the public conscience has seen case loads for solicitors and local authorities increase, but as tragic as the Baby P case is, it is good that it has galvanised the public into voicing concerns where they suspect child abuse,” he added.

The Baby P case, hit the headlines after he was killed when he was only 17 months old at the hands of his mother and her violent partner.

He suffered more than 50 injuries despite being on the at-risk register and receiving 60 visits from social workers, police and health professionals in an eight-month period before his death in London in August 2007.

“Like everywhere in the country Leicestershire has its problems and it is vital that the public continue this vigilance,” added Mr Abbott.
